Output 23dd510c6d3e53becd9ff674bc86b3baa1e7a978247130558df01144a7bc00bb:0

value
84126359
script pubkey
OP_0 OP_PUSHBYTES_20 107c5f6b0cb0aaff494e777a4100efc22612b566
address
bc1qzp7976cvkz407j2wwaayzq80cgnp9dtx3ukzzr
transaction
23dd510c6d3e53becd9ff674bc86b3baa1e7a978247130558df01144a7bc00bb
spent
true